Book of Leviticus - Chapter 17 - Verse 5

17:5
To the end that the children of Israel may bring their sacrifices, which they offer in the open field, even that they may bring them unto the LORD, unto the door of the tabernacle of the congregation, unto the priest, and offer them for peace offerings unto the LORD.

Meaning

In this verse, the importance of the proper location for offering sacrifices is highlighted. The children of Israel are instructed to bring their sacrifices to the tabernacle of the congregation, specifically to the door where the priest is waiting to receive them. This act of bringing their offerings to the designated place signifies the Israelites' obedience to the Lord and their respect for the established rituals of worship. By offering their sacrifices in the proper manner, the children of Israel are demonstrating their commitment to following God's commandments and participating in the religious practices that unite them as a community. The reference to peace offerings also indicates a desire for reconciliation and harmony with the Lord, emphasizing the significance of sacrifice as a means of seeking forgiveness and divine favor.
